Antique copper jug – PEKTORLU BURSA – Turkey, 1st half of the 20th century – 24 cm

Item description / Lot Description
PL:
The item up for auction is an authentic, artisanal jug (ibrik / güğüm) made of hammered copper, with brass and tin-plated finishing elements. On the bottom of the vessel there is a clear, oval workshop signature with the inscription “PEKTORLU BURSA,” indicating the item’s origin from the Turkish city Bursa, renowned for its copper-engraving traditions.

The jug features a classic Anatolian form: a wide, stable body transitioning into a slender neck, traditionally shaped spout, and a solid brass handle mounted with rivets. The lid is fitted on a functional brass hinge. A wonderful collectible item, ideal for interiors in vintage, rustic, or oriental style.

Specifications & Condition
* Height: 24 cm
* Width (body, excluding handle & spout): 15 cm
* Material: Hammered copper, brass, tinning
* Origin: Turkey (Bursa) / Turkey (Bursa)
* Period: 1st half of the 20th century (approx. 1920–1950)
